A device designed for automated maintenance of swimming pools, characterized by a distinct helical structure and typically a blue color, efficiently removes debris and contaminants from the pool’s surfaces. These cleaners employ various propulsion methods, often hydraulic or electric, to navigate the pool and suction or scrub away dirt, leaves, and algae. An example is a robotic unit that autonomously traverses the pool floor, walls, and waterline, collecting particulate matter into an internal filter.

The adoption of these automated systems offers several advantages. It reduces the manual labor required for pool upkeep, freeing pool owners from time-consuming chores. Regular use contributes to improved water quality by preventing the buildup of harmful substances and minimizing the need for chemical treatments. Furthermore, the historical context reveals a progression from basic suction cleaners to sophisticated robotic models with programmable features and advanced filtration capabilities.

A parking structure employing a specific ramp configuration to facilitate vehicular circulation. This design utilizes two intertwined, continuous ramps resembling a double helix. Vehicles ascend or descend using either of these interconnected spirals, leading to and from parking levels within the structure. This configuration aims to optimize space utilization and traffic flow compared to traditional ramp systems.

Such structures offer potential advantages in areas with limited land availability, maximizing the number of parking spaces within a given footprint. The efficient ramp design can reduce travel distances for vehicles entering or exiting the facility, potentially minimizing congestion and improving overall user experience. Historically, these designs have been implemented in urban centers and areas requiring high-density parking solutions, contributing to more efficient land use and transportation infrastructure.
